Maurice Elias

Maurice J. Elias, Ph.D. is Professor of Psychology and Contributing Faculty in Jewish Studies at Rutgers University in New Brunswick, NJ. He co-directs the Academy for SEL in Schools. Among his books are The Joys and Oys of Parenting: Insight and Wisdom from the Jewish Tradition (Behrman House) and Talking Treasure: Stories to Help Build Emotional Intelligence and Resilience in Young Children (Research Press), with Jewish storytellers Devorah Omer and Vered Hankin.
